Lucy's story in the new season of "Tell Me Lies" is about to get darker and more twisted than ever before.

After Stephen (Jackson White) and Lucy (Grace Van Patten) get back together and then break up again in Season 3 (streaming on Hulu Tuesdays at 9 p.m. PT/12 a.m. ET), Lucy begins to unravel.

"I realized how much she may not like herself, which was a very sad realization," Van Patten tells USA TODAY about her character's journey. "For the first two seasons, she's been very dignified in what her actions are, and she's stubborn, and this season is the first time you see that shell disintegrate."

Now, enter Alex (Costa D'Angelo), a brooding and charming drug dealer and college student studying psychology, who knows Bree (Cat Missal) from their time in the foster care system. D'Angelo was cast as a series regular in May, and his character is already taking the Internet by storm after Hulu released a surprise third episode during the Tuesday season premiere.
